Output 75852566877b2a972b02f1954dc35af5094eace7d180829eb6605db7547ef5d9:3

value
275220868
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b95bac2e251d4c172bff1a4c5d7207ca842f34a OP_EQUALVERIFY OP_CHECKSIG
address
1CGTUzAtvRewSZZNqrKmQW2a73QcmZofjk
transaction
75852566877b2a972b02f1954dc35af5094eace7d180829eb6605db7547ef5d9
spent
true